Nagarjuna reveals secret to looking 40 at 65: ‘I don’t starve myself, haven’t missed exercise; never allow myself to get disheartened’ - Exclusive

The National Award-winning actor Nagarjuna is one of the beloved stars who is not only known for his acting prowess, but also for his healthy lifestyle. The ‘Mass’ actor is 65 years old and doesn’t look a day over 40. Everyone wants to know the secret of his reverse aging. And while we had an exclusive conversation with him, Nagarjuna gave us three important things that he follows, and it’s more than just diet and exercise.

Nagarjuna reveals the secret to looking 40 at 65

When questioned about what makes him look and stay young after all these years, the actor, with all modesty, said, “I don’t know. I eat correctly. I don’t starve myself or go on a crash diet.”

South Superstar Nagarjuna Celebrates 66th Birthday In Style

Then he shared the second non-negotiable he has when it comes to his health, “I haven’t missed my morning exercise for fortyfive years, from when there were no gyms, unless I am really unwell.” Last but not least, the third and most essential element of his lifestyle goes beyond just surface work. He said, “Most importantly, I think positively. I never allow myself to get disheartened, no matter what the situation.”An example of his positive thinking is also reflected when he opened up about his 2025 journey and said that it has been ‘very satisfying.’ Spreading opitmisim he continued, “On both the personal and professional front, I couldn’t have hoped for more. My younger son, Akhil, got married to a lovely girl, and he is very happy with her. My elder son, Chaitanya, got married on December 24, and they have just completed one year of happily married life.”

When Rajinikath joked about Nagarjuna looking younger

On a lighter note, even Rajinikanth couldn’t get over Nagarjuna’s reverse aging techniques.During an event of ‘Coolie,’ the movie in which Rajinikanth and Nagarjuna shared the screen, ‘Thalaivar’ also pulled the ‘Shiva’ actor’s leg. Establishing that Nagarjuna never looks like he has aged, Rajinikanth said, “I once acted with him 33 (34) years ago (Shanti Kranthi in 1991). He looked younger than he did back then. I’ve lost all my hair, and yet he’s maintaining his skin and physique. I asked him how he did it, and he said, nothing but exercise and diet.” Go to Source
